Subject: DR drill — Pondlark CSV Import Wizard

Hi,

As release manager, please note Thursday's disaster-recovery drill will restore the Pondlark CSV Import Wizard from cold backups, including column-mapping templates and delimiter presets. We will verify the restored wizard against last week's import manifests. To unlock the backup archive during the drill, use the recovery passphrase written below.

unlock words, hahip-baduf: holwyn-istath-julvan

**Ticket RC-2087: Expired credentials blocking websocket reconnect fix**

Welcome to the Tidemark team. While investigating the reconnect loop in our Harborline websocket gateway, we discovered that the staging credentials you were issued expired last Friday, which is why every reconnect attempt returns an authorization failure rather than reproducing the actual bug. Please do not reuse the old token from the contractor handbook; it has been revoked. To continue debugging, configure your client with the fresh key provided below.

service key, tadup-tahog: zpat7_wB1tnEL

### Runbook: Audit-Log Viewer Integration (Vantagrel)

Plugin authors querying the Vantagrel audit-log viewer must request read-only scopes and page results in batches of 500 or fewer. Entries are immutable; if your plugin needs annotations, write them to the sidecar store rather than the log itself. Rate limits reset hourly. When reporting rendering discrepancies, always include the viewer build you tested against, which for the current sandbox deployment is listed below.

pipeline stamp: htk14_378fd70323001d

## Deployment

The Gustrel fan-out service consumes alerts from the Skyvane ingest bus and delivers them to registered plugin endpoints in parallel. Plugin authors should deploy their receivers behind the provided sidecar, which handles retries, ordering, and backpressure on your behalf. Run at least two replicas; the fan-out assumes a receiver can vanish mid-burst. Latency budgets are strict during severe-weather surges, so load-test against the Dunmoor staging mesh first. The staging fan-out runs with the following configuration.

deployment values, faduf-tawep:
SORDOR_LOG_LEVEL=error
SORDOR_METRICS_HOST=metrics.sordor.nelvrolabs.internal
SORDOR_POOL_SIZE=4